Understanding the Sneaker Release Landscape
Before diving into the how, let’s understand the what. The sneaker world operates on a unique release calendar, driven by hype, limited quantities, and collaborations. Knowing the players and the process is crucial.
Key Players in the Sneaker Release Game
- Brands: Nike, Adidas, Jordan Brand, New Balance, and many more. They control the releases.
- Retailers: Foot Locker, Champs Sports, Finish Line, boutiques like Kith and Concepts, and online stores like SNKRS, Adidas Confirmed, and retailers’ websites.
- Resellers: Individuals and businesses who buy and sell sneakers, often at inflated prices.
- Sneakerheads: The passionate community of collectors and enthusiasts.
Release Types and Strategies
- General Releases (GR): Widely available, but still often sell out quickly due to high demand.
- Limited Releases (LR): Smaller quantities, higher hype, harder to obtain.
- Exclusive Releases: Often specific to certain retailers or regions.
- Collaborations: Sneakers created with designers, artists, or other brands, typically very limited.
Each release type demands a different strategy. General releases require speed and preparation, while limited and exclusive releases often involve raffles, early access programs, and bots.

1. Learn About Cook Groups
Cook groups are paid communities that provide early access to information, release links, and bot setups. They can be expensive, but offer valuable resources.
- Benefits: Early information, bot support, and a community of like-minded individuals.
- Research: Do your research and choose a reputable group.
2. Consider a Proxy Server
A proxy server can mask your IP address, allowing you to bypass geographical restrictions and increase your chances of success.
- Benefits: Access to releases in different regions and potentially faster checkout.
- Risks: Can be expensive and require technical knowledge.
